Need help with Picasa picture program

I did this last year, but for the life of me, I can't make it work this year.

We want to send calendars to friends and relatives for Christmas. We have the individual albums created and the pictures we want for the calendar in the albums. Each album is labeled with the relative's name.

What I can't do is put the albums on a CD to take to the store to get the calendars printed. All I can get is the first picture of the album, but not the entire album.

I've tried highlighting all the pictures in the album, click on file, save as, and selecting the CD drive. I still only get the first picture.

What am I doing wrong?????

Originally Posted by radshooter
I thought I was doing something like that. How do I save them to folders?

Thanks
right click you desktop, create a new folder called 'someone's calendar'. This will create a folder on your desktop that is easy to find.

In picassa when you open up your project or in your case a calendar. you should be able to use a save as function in the file menu. save the calendar as 'someone's calendar' and select the folder that you just created as the location where you want to save it to.

Do this for all you calendars. One folder for each calendar, when you have them all done, create a new folder called christmas calendars on your desktop and drag all of your new calendar folders into it.

After all the files are in the christmas calendar folder, burn the christmas calendar folder to a cd. this should work. If not check back in and we'll do some trouble shooting. but let me know how this works in case someone else has the same problem.
